I just received a Carl Ziess Jena DDR 2.8/50mm lens from Ebay. This lens only cost 8.00 inc P&P, then I tried it on the 350D and it would not focus to infinity and there was a hair in the lens itself between the two pieces of glass. Damm I just bought a piece of junk. A quick search on the web I found this site how to service the exact same lens. Anyway to cut a long storey short I took it apart down to the aperture blades, took the hair out then 3 hours later finally getting the focusing barrel screwed in the right place it works brilliantly. Its not multicoated but it still a sharp lens. Now lets do a quick search for a "Takumar (Tak) 50mm f1.4" on Ebay no no no somebody stop me :o)
